WebCROSS in sign language. How to sign "cross" in American Sign Language (ASL)? Meaning: a shape of the cross. Meaning: to go or extend across or to the other side of a road, path, etc.). See ACROSS. Meaning: to pass in an opposite or different direction. See INTERSECT, INTERTWINE, INTERWEAVE.
